What is FaceTite?

FaceTite is an FDA-approved rejuvenation procedure that works well for anyone whose face shows evidence of aging. FaceTite uses radiofrequency (RF) energy to improve skin tone, primarily in your face and neck, including your jawline and jowls.

FaceTite stimulates collagen production, which supports and firms your skin. The procedure is much less invasive than a traditional facelift. FaceTite is considered a safe surgery that can benefit all skin types. It generally produces less pain than other face-tightening procedures.

The technique can often be paired with liposuction in a procedure known as RFAL or radiofrequency-assisted liposuction. Removing excess fat can help create a more contoured result. As a standalone procedure, FaceTite requires only a few tiny, bladeless incisions to insert a thin probe that will be used to deliver targeted RF energy beneath the outer layers of the skin.

Risks and possible side effects

FaceTite is considered an extremely safe procedure, as it does not require general anesthesia, repositioning of muscles, or lengthy downtime. FaceTite does produce some temporary swelling and bruising. Mild numbness is normal and resolves in four to eight weeks. While extremely rare, nerve damage is possible. Like any surgical procedure, FaceTite comes with risks, including infections, bleeding, and scarring. Preparing for your FaceTite procedure

You should stay at a stable weight for several months before your procedure. Gaining or losing weight could alter your results. Tell your doctor about all medications and supplements you are taking. For at least several days before your surgery, avoid aspirin and other non-steroidal anti-inflammatory drugs (NSAIDs) that might promote excessive bleeding. After receiving FaceTite, patients will need someone to drive them home.

Your FaceTite Procedure

FaceTite is performed at your plastic surgeon’s office under local anesthesia. Your doctor will numb your treatment areas with a medicated cream. You may also be given an oral sedative, depending on the nature of your treatment. Your surgeon will make a small, bladeless incision near every treatment area. The incisions are so small that visible scarring is avoided, and no sutures are necessary.

Small probes are inserted through these tiny incisions. The probes transmit radiofrequency energy that heats your underlying facial tissues and liquifies facial fat. A separate tube suctions out this liquid. Most Boston FaceTite patients report that the procedure is quite comfortable. Throughout the surgery, you will be conscious enough to communicate.

FaceTite is a relatively new procedure that was approved for use in the U.S. in 2016. But the radiofrequency technology behind FaceTite has been safely used in MRIs and other medical scans and treatments for years. The FaceTite technique was created to treat delicate areas of the skin without damaging sensitive tissues. The probes used in your FaceTite procedure have thermal controls for enhanced safety. The devices automatically shut down if they reach a temperature that could cause tissue damage.

Your procedure will be completed within a few hours, and no overnight hospital stay is required. You can go home after your procedure, but, again, you will need someone to drive you.

Recovery after FaceTite

Once your procedure is completed, you’ll be provided with compression garments that you’ll wear home. These garments help ensure proper healing and skin tightening. You may be instructed to wear a head garment around the clock for a few days and then just at night for a longer period. You will likely experience some swelling lasting up to ten days.

One recent study noted that most patients went back to work after two days.

Your skin will continue to tighten for three to six months. Be sure to use sunscreen anytime you are exposed to even indirect sunlight.

We may recommend medical-grade skincare products to maximize the speed of recovery and maximize your results.

Results

You should expect an impressive improvement in skin laxity as you recover, and your skin tone should continue to improve for several months. While individual results will vary, the benefits of your FaceTite procedure can last for up to five years.

It is important to remember that no other cosmetic procedure will produce the dramatic results of a full facelift.
